Portrait of a Man, Seated in Front of a Writing Desk, 1795?1800, Watercolor over graphite with touches of gouache, sheet: 14 x 10 1/16 in. (35. 6 x 25. 6 cm), Drawings, Henry Edridge (British, Paddington, Middlesex 1769?1821 London), In the 1790s Edridge was a proponent of a new type of small-scale full-length portrait drawn in graphite and finished using ink and watercolor washes. This striking example depicts a country gentleman at work in his study; the artist emphasized his bookcase by adding a strip of paper at the top
